Fehler 403: Verboten (Forbidden): Der Server versteht die Anfrage, weigert sich jedoch, sie auszuführen. Dies ist normalerweise auf Zugriffsrechte zurückzuführen.
Mögliche Ursachen:
- Falsche Datei- oder Verzeichnisberechtigungen.
- Zugriffsbeschränkung nach IP-Adresse.
- Falsche Konfiguration der
.htaccess
-Datei.
Lösungen:
-
Überprüfen Sie die Datei- und Verzeichnisberechtigungen:
shsudo chmod -R 755 /path/to/your/website sudo chown -R www-data:www-data /path/to/your/website
-
Überprüfen Sie die
.htaccess
-Einstellungen:- Stellen Sie sicher, dass die Datei keine Regeln enthält, die den Zugriff einschränken.
-
Überprüfen Sie die Serverkonfiguration:
- Stellen Sie sicher, dass die Konfigurationsdatei des Servers (z. B. Apache oder Nginx) korrekt eingerichtet ist.
Beschreibung
Fehler 404: Nicht gefunden (Not Found): Der Server kann die angeforderte Ressource nicht finden. Dies liegt normalerweise an einer fehlenden Seite oder einer falschen URL.
Mögliche Ursachen:
- Falsche URL.
- Löschung oder Verschiebung der Seite.
- Routingprobleme auf dem Server.
Lösungen:
-
Überprüfen Sie die URL:
- Stellen Sie sicher, dass Sie die richtige URL eingeben.
-
Überprüfen Sie die Dateiexistenz:
- Stellen Sie sicher, dass die angeforderte Datei im richtigen Verzeichnis vorhanden ist.
-
Konfigurieren Sie das Routing:
- Stellen Sie sicher, dass die Konfigurationsdateien des Servers korrekt eingerichtet sind, um Routen zu verarbeiten.
Beschreibung
Fehler 500: Interner Serverfehler (Internal Server Error): Ein allgemeiner Serverfehler. Dies kann durch verschiedene Probleme auf dem Server verursacht werden.
Mögliche Ursachen:
- Fehler in Skripten (z. B. PHP).
- Probleme mit
.htaccess
-Dateien. - Probleme mit dem Datenbankserver.
Lösungen:
-
Überprüfen Sie die Serverprotokolle:
shsudo tail -f /var/log/apache2/error.log
-
Überprüfen Sie
.htaccess
-Dateien:- Stellen Sie sicher, dass die Dateien keine Konfigurationsfehler enthalten.
-
Überprüfen Sie die Skripte:
- Stellen Sie sicher, dass in Skripten wie PHP keine Syntaxfehler vorhanden sind.
-
Überprüfen Sie die Datenbankeinstellungen:
- Stellen Sie sicher, dass die Datenbank ordnungsgemäß funktioniert und die Verbindungseinstellungen korrekt sind.
Beschreibung
Fehler 502: Schlechte Gateway (Bad Gateway): Der als Gateway oder Proxy fungierende Server hat eine ungültige Antwort vom Upstream-Server erhalten.
Mögliche Ursachen:
- Probleme mit dem Upstream-Server.
- Netzwerkverbindungsprobleme.
- Probleme mit dem Proxy-Server oder dem Lastenausgleich.
Lösungen:
-
Überprüfen Sie den Status des Upstream-Servers:
- Stellen Sie sicher, dass der Upstream-Server läuft.
-
Überprüfen Sie die Netzwerkverbindung:
- Stellen Sie sicher, dass keine Probleme mit dem Netzwerk oder der Firewall bestehen.
-
Starten Sie den Proxy-Server oder den Lastenausgleich neu:
shsudo systemctl restart nginx
Beschreibung
Fehler 503: Dienst nicht verfügbar (Service Unavailable): Der Server kann die Anfrage vorübergehend aufgrund von Überlastung oder Wartungsarbeiten nicht bearbeiten.